The Twelve Days of Christmas crept into existence sometime in the 1700s, appearing in a children’s book called Mirth With-out Mischief — long before English baritone and composer Frederic Austin added an all-too-familiar melody. There are many variations of the song, with “colly” birds that are black as coal, bears a-baiting, ships a-sailing, and ducks a-quacking.
Some even call out the gift receiver as being someone’s mother instead of their true love. So, we thought it would be fun to make our own version of the forfeit game-turned-carol.
